The recursive split

2016 DAO-style recursive withdrawal. An attacker exploited a reentrancy flaw to drain a public investment fund before the balance was zeroed.

The validator majority

Ronin-style validator-key compromise on a cross-chain bridge. Attacker obtained majority validator signatures to authorise fraudulent withdrawals.

The forged signature

Wormhole-style signature-verification bypass on a cross-chain bridge. A missing validation step allowed fabricated guardian signatures to pass.
